* [PATCH 1/2] media: i2c: ov5640: Check for devm_gpiod_get_optional() error

The power down and reset GPIO are optional, but the return value
from devm_gpiod_get_optional() needs to be checked and propagated
in the case of error, so that probe deferral can work.

diff --git a/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c b/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c
index 759d60c6d630..afe7920557a8 100644
--- a/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c
+++ b/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c
@@ -3022,9 +3022,14 @@ static int ov5640_probe(struct i2c_client *client,
 	/* request optional power down pin */
 	sensor->pwdn_gpio = devm_gpiod_get_optional(dev, "powerdown",
 						    GPIOD_OUT_HIGH);
+	if (IS_ERR(sensor->pwdn_gpio))
+		return PTR_ERR(sensor->pwdn_gpio);
+
 	/* request optional reset pin */
 	sensor->reset_gpio = devm_gpiod_get_optional(dev, "reset",
 						     GPIOD_OUT_HIGH);
+	if (IS_ERR(sensor->reset_gpio))
+		return PTR_ERR(sensor->reset_gpio);
 
 	v4l2_i2c_subdev_init(&sensor->sd, client, &ov5640_subdev_ops);

* [PATCH 2/2] media: i2c: ov5640: Fix the order for enabling regulators

According to the OV5640 datasheet the following sequence needs to be
followed when powering the OV5640 supplies:

- DOVDD
- AVDD
- DVDD

So follow this order inside the ov5640_supply_name[] array, so that
the regulator_bulk() functions can enable the regulator in the
correct sequence.

diff --git a/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c b/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c
index afe7920557a8..4cd246812ae2 100644
--- a/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c
+++ b/drivers/media/i2c/ov5640.c
@@ -158,8 +158,8 @@ static const int ov5640_framerates[] = {
 /* regulator supplies */
 static const char * const ov5640_supply_name[] = {
 	"DOVDD", /* Digital I/O (1.8V) supply */
-	"DVDD",  /* Digital Core (1.5V) supply */
 	"AVDD",  /* Analog (2.8V) supply */
+	"DVDD",  /* Digital Core (1.5V) supply */
 };
 
 #define OV5640_NUM_SUPPLIES ARRAY_SIZE(ov5640_supply_name)
